Legendary Bacon Wrapped Smokies with Paleo BBQ Sauce Paleo Grubs

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Cut bacon in thirds. Wrap each 1/3 piece of bacon around a cocktail frank. Secure bacon with skewer. Repeat until all bacon is used. Place on baking sheet lined with aluminum foil. Drizzle with maple syrup and sprinkle with brown sugar. Bake 20-30 minutes, or until sugar is melted and bacon is browned and crisp.

Bacon Wrapped Brown Sugar Smokies

Put brown sugar in a small shallow dish. Add a slice of bacon, pressing down to adhere sugar. Roll up a lil' smokie in the bacon and place on a baking sheet (line it with foil first for easier cleanup). Repeat with all ingredients. Bake smokies for 25 minutes. Turn on broiler and crisp bacon a little more if necessary.

Bacon Wrapped Little Smokies an appetizer that everyone will love!

Directions. Cut each bacon strip in half widthwise. Wrap one piece of bacon around each sausage. Place in a foil-lined 15x10x1-in. baking pan. Sprinkle with brown sugar. Bake, uncovered, at 400° until bacon is crisp and sausage is heated through, 30-40 minutes. Bacon-Wrapped Smokies Tips.
